Grasping EVO ICL

Evo ICL, or the EVO ICL, is an innovative vision correction procedure designed to target various visual errors, including nearsightedness, astigmatism, and even extreme shortsightedness. Unlike traditional options, such as LASIK, the EVO ICL procedure involves inserting a body-friendly lens positioned behind the iris to improve vision without changing the cornea. The lens functions in harmony with the eye’s natural structure, offering patients a possibly reversible solution to sight restoration.

One of the main advantages of EVO ICL is its potential to deliver enduring vision correction for individuals who may not be eligible candidates for LASIK procedure, specifically those with narrow corneas or high refractive errors. The lens is designed to be a secure and effective alternative, yielding a rapid recovery time and little discomfort. Patients can appreciate sharper eyesight and a diminished dependence on spectacles or lens wear shortly subsequent to the surgery.

Another notable benefit of the Evo ICL procedure is its reduced incidence of side effects. Unlike other vision correction methods, patients often complain of reduced issues with eye dryness, making it a more appealing option for those sensitive to this usual post-operative issue. Our EVO ICL Technique

This EVO ICL procedure begins with a comprehensive consultation, in which your eye health is evaluated to determine if you are a suitable candidate. This includes a comprehensive eye exam and discussions about your vision goals and health background. Patients with thin corneas or those who experience dry eye may find EVO ICL to be a better option compared to alternative vision correction techniques like LASIK. Your surgeon will outline the steps necessary in the surgery and address any concerns you may have.

During the procedure, local anesthesia is applied to ensure your comfort. The surgeon makes a small incision in the cornea, allowing the EVO implantable collamer lens to be inserted behind the iris and in front of the native lens of the eye. The entire procedure typically takes approximately 15 to 30 minutes for both eyes. You will stay awake but relaxed throughout, with your vision being improved immediately or shortly after the insertion.

After the procedure, patients are observed for a short period before being cleared to go home. It is common to experience some mild discomfort and blurred vision initially, which should improve over a few days. Following your surgeon's post-operative care instructions is crucial for achieving the best possible outcome and ensuring a smooth recovery. Regular follow-up appointments will help monitoring the healing process and the results of your new vision correction.

Recovery and Results

The healing process after EVO ICL surgery is generally seamless, with numerous patients reporting improved vision right away. It is common to have unclear vision or variations in sharpness during the early days as the eyes adapt to the ICL. Patients are generally advised to take a few days off work to allow for recovery and healing. Following the post-operative instructions issued by the surgeon, such as using authorized eye drops and avoiding certain tasks, can facilitate a quicker and easier healing process.

The majority of patients claim seeing clear improvements in their vision within a limited duration, often within a week. The final results may take a bit more time as the visual system become acclimated. Analyzing Sight Correction Options

As considering sight correction, it's essential to examine the multiple choices available. EVO ICL, has been increasing favor for its ability to correct severe cases of nearsightedness and astigmatism, which makes it an outstanding option for those who could not qualify for Laser-Assisted In Situ Keratomileusis due to reduced corneas or various reasons. Unlike LASIK, which alters the cornea, the EVO ICL includes implanting a lens located posterior to the pupil, preserving the original form of the eye. This approach delivers a reversible solution and lowers the likelihood of dry eyes, a common side effect of various treatments.

LASIK and Small Incision Lenticule Extraction are other commonly used vision correction surgeries. LASIK is famous for its quick recovery and success rate for moderate to mild vision issues. Conversely, Small Incision Lenticule Extraction, a modern technique, uses a minimally invasive technique that can provide less postoperative discomfort and quicker recovery. However, both Laser-Assisted In Situ Keratomileusis and Small Incision Lenticule Extraction require ample thickness of the cornea, which can limit the eligibility of certain patients. This is the point at which EVO ICL excels, particularly for patients who have high refractive errors or individuals whose ocular structures do not satisfy the required criteria for additional interventions.

In the end, the most suitable vision correction option is determined by individual eye conditions, lifestyle, and subjective preferences. Meeting with an experienced ophthalmologist is crucial to assessing the pros and negatives of all methods.
